Acrobatty Bunny
Trailer: Acrobatty Bunny
Year: 1946
Studio: Warner Bros. Pictures, Warner Bros. Cartoons
Director: Robert McKimson
Cast: Mel Blanc
Crew: Cal Dalton (Animation), Richard H. Thomas (Background Designer), Carl W. Stalling (Original Music Composer), Treg Brown (Editor), Warren Foster (Story), Richard Bickenbach (Animation)
Runtime: 8 minutes
Release: Jun 29, 1946
